The Coast of Maine Raised Bed Mix is a premium landscaping supply designed to enhance the aesthetic and functional qualities of your outdoor spaces. This blend is formulated to provide optimal growth conditions for a variety of plants, making it an excellent choice for both professional landscapers and gardening enthusiasts.
The Coast of Maine Castine Blend is designed to improve soil fertility and moisture retention, ensuring that your plants receive the essential nutrients they need to thrive. Its organic components help to foster beneficial microbial activity in the soil, which can lead to healthier root systems and more vibrant plant growth.
For best results, apply the Coast of Maine Castine Blend evenly across the desired area. Incorporate it into existing soil to enhance its quality or use it as a top dressing to provide additional nutrients. Regularly monitor moisture levels to ensure optimal plant health.
Store in a cool, dry place to maintain its quality. Keep the blend sealed in its original packaging when not in use.
